Ordinals
beta
Sat 534633758648449
decimal
106926.3758648449
degree
0°106926′78″3758648449‴
percentile
25.45875043983554%
name
kbgyuiaipnk
cycle
0
epoch
0
period
53
block
106926
offset
3758648449
timestamp
2011-02-08 17:13:48 UTC
rarity
common
prev
next